An SBA franchise loan is a type of financing supported by the SBA 7(a) or SBA 504 program, designed to assist those starting a franchise business. The SBA offers a Franchise Financing Resources that lists approved franchise brands whose Franchise Disclosure Documents (FDDs) have passed SBA’s scrutiny. If your chosen franchise is on the list (which includes most major brands), your loan approval process benefits as the SBA has assessed the franchise structure already. SBA franchise loans offer competitive terms, up to 25 years for repayment, and funding up to $5 million, covering franchise fees, establishment expenses, equipment, real estate, and operating cash within one package.
Initial expenses for starting a franchise can differ significantly depending on the brand and sector. Budget-friendly franchises (like home services, tutoring, or cleaning in South Bound Brook) often need an investment ranging from $50,000 to $150,000. Mid-tier franchises (such as casual dining, fitness centers, or retail locations) generally require $250,000 to $750,000. Prominent quick-service restaurant franchises (McDonald's, Chick-fil-A, Subway) and hotel franchises can range from $500,000 to $2,000,000+. These costs include the initial franchise fee ($10,000-$50,000+), build-out and real estate, equipment, initial inventory, franchisor training fees, and working capital to sustain operations for the first 6-12 months. The FDD for each franchise brand breaks down expected costs in detail.
To qualify for SBA franchise loans, a minimum personal credit score of 680 is typically required, though a score of 700 or higher is favored for more favorable rates and smoother approvals. Traditional franchise financing options from banks typically require a credit score of 660 or higher. Digital lending platforms may grant franchise loans for applicants with scores as low as 600, though this generally comes with elevated interest rates. Financing programs linked to franchisors often have specific credit prerequisites. Lenders also closely assess your net asset value, accessible liquid funds, and past management experience, as well as the reputation of the franchise brand itself. A well-established franchise with a successful history can sometimes offset a lower credit score.
Absolutely - a key benefit of franchising is the structured support provided through extensive training, operational guides, marketing assistance, and continuous mentorship, which lessens the lender’s worries about your experience. Many SBA franchise loans are accessible to new entrepreneurs without any background in the sector. However, showcasing management experience or relevant skills (like finance, sales, or operations) can significantly enhance your application. Some franchises do set their own standards for minimum net worth and liquid assets, along with preferred professional backgrounds. The focus should be on proving your financial stability, dedication, and readiness to adhere to the franchise's operational model.
